Heavy rainfall is not the only source of flooding. Interior concerns like burst pipelines as well as overflows can lead to emergency situation flooding. Regrettably, this will likewise create damages to your residential property. Failure to attend to the issue will certainly rise the damages and also raise the chances of mold and mildew development. Keep on reading to discover what you can when handling emergency flooding.
1. Turn Off Key Water Valve
Pipes can break due to cold temps, high stress, obstruction, water heater problems, and also various other factors. No issue the cause, you should act promptly to guarantee porous house materials, devices, and also home fur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damage.
2. Turn off the Circuit Breaker
With a big flooding, you require to ensure the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can create injuries or deaths. Switch off the circuit breaker to stop electrocution. If you can not do it, make a quick phone call to the power business to close the main line.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.
3. Move Crucial Damp Times
When it pertains to conserving your furnishings as well as devices, time is important. For this reason, you have to relocate whatever sharpen valuables you can from the afflicted location to a completely dry place. This hinders more damages since the longer they soak in water, the more extensive the trouble.
4. Paper the Level of Damages
Remember of all the damages inflicted by the ruptured pipeline. You can jot down notes, take pictures, as well as collect video clips. This is a wonderful means to give proof to collect claims on your home insurance policy protection. With documentation, you can additionally get a clear image of the extent of the damages.
5. Eliminate Water ASAP
You have to do away with excess water as soon as possible. Must there be a huge qu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for extraction. You can lease this equipment if you don't possess one. If it's late during the night, the convention container technique likewise functions. Use a number of jugs and also manual labor to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can take in the rest with old shirts or towels. You might additionally require to get rid of broken products like carpetings as well as rugs.
6. Dry the Location
You can also establish up electric followers and placed them in the strongest setup. A dehumidifier likewise functions in taking out dampness to protect against mold and also mold and mildews.
7. Work with Specialists
When you endure substantial water damages because of em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ipeline, you can work with a remediation expert to rebuild as well as restore your residence. Above all, do not neglect to call a respectable plumber to repair the ruptured pipe as well as examine the rest of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will be rendered worthless.

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one location, you ought to be used now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be prepared for bad weather condition. If you're not utilized to obtaining pounded by high winds and also difficult rainfall, you most likely do not have an concept how best to deal with a storm scenario.
For starters, tornados do not just come without a caution. Weather stations keep an eye on the environment all the time. If a tornado is possible, they will provide 2 kinds of cautions: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a feasible storm in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an abnormally windy day and also some rain. The tornado may or may not come, but this is the time to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for news and updates.
Tornado war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ed toward your location. By that time, the roads could be flooded as well as website traffic is negative. You do not want to be captured in your cars and truck in bad weather condition.
Snowstorm-- generally happens in winter season as well as indicates heavy snow, solid winds and also wind chill. When a caution is issued, avoid traveling as long as possible and also stay indoors. There is no use revealing yourself outdoors where you can obtain caught in traffic or in places where you will be difficult to get to or even worse, find.
For all our modern technology, no one can quit a tornado from coming. The only method to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Things don't always spoil during tornados, yet weather condition is unpredictable and also anything can happen. To help you get ready for a storm emergency situation, right here are a few pointers:
Spruce up.
Wear sufficient clothing to keep on your own warm. Warmth may not be offered in your home so get additional layers and also coverings to maintain your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ots all set.
Have food all set.
Emergency stipulations are a must during storm emergency situations. If the tornado obtains too poor and the roads are flooded, you will have a trouble going out to the grocery store stores.
Keep bottles of water useful. Clean water may be difficult to find by during truly bad conditions and the worst point you can do is suffer from dehydration because you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the tub.
You'll need extra water for cleaning and also flushing the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ers as well as pails with water. If you have children in your house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and also keeping youngsters away from the shower room unless necessary.
Emergency package
Have a medical or very first set all set and also ensure it's freshly-stocked. It must have dis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as essential medications. It's also a good idea to have one more set in your cars and truck.
If any person in your family members is under unique drug, see to it you have sufficient supplies to last until after the storm mores than as well as medication stores are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power blackouts during storm emergency situations. You will not have any type of electrical energy, so stock on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have added fresh batteries and matches in case you go out.
If you can't activ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m as well as will certainly keep you upgraded.
You might need warm water during the period when power is not yet readily available, so keep a small tank of gas around simply in case. Your outside barbecue grill will do perfectly.
Obtain an alternate shelter.
Make sure you have sufficient gas in your tank in case you require to obtain out of the house and also action some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have much better opportunities of being secure and dry.
